Ellise Shafer When the news came out in December that “The Grand Tour” — Jeremy Clarkson, James May and Richard Hammond’s post-“Top Gear” automotive series — would be coming to an end, fans were left wondering why. But, in a new interview with The Times, Clarkson has delivered a cheeky yet straightforward answer: it’s because he’s “unfit and fat and old.” Clarkson told The Times that the show “is immensely physical, and when you’re unfit and fat and old, which I am…” He also feels the trio has done just about “everything you can do with a car.” “I’ve driven cars higher than anyone else and further north than anyone else,” Clarkson said.
